Image Based Lighting (IBL) allows you to use High-Dynamic-Range (HDR) images as. To efficiently use sIBL images you would need to set up an entire Shading Network.
Smart IBL (sIBL) is a open system that allows a quick and easy IBL setup in 3D Applications. It especially takes care of the issue Of color noise gets created in the rendered animation caused by Final Gather. sIBL uses blurred images in combination with the original Image use in the reflections.
To work with sIBL Images you need two Parts
- sIBL-GUI is a Gallery Viewer that can send Images
- A plugin that allows your 3D Application to receive the image from sIBL-GUI
The software can be downloaded for free at:
There are two types of sIBL Sets:
- Environments, usually spherical images of locations
- Light sets, images of specific lights used in a studio environment for lighting
WHERE TO GET (FREE) SIBL SETS?
Either create your own using “sIBL-Edit”
- The sIBL archive: http://www.hdrlabs.com/sibl/archive.html
- Monthly sIBL image: http://www.hdrlabs.com/sibl/monthly.html
- Forum: http://www.hdrlabs.com/cgi-bin/forum/YaBB.pl?board=images
REQUIRED SIBL SOFTWARE:
- (optional) sIBL-Edit : Creates sIBL sets
- sIBL-GUI: Is a Viewer and Library of sIBL sets
- Loader Plugin: Connects sIBL-GUI to the 3D Program
- Download and install sIBL-GUI http://www.hdrlabs.com/sibl/framework.html
- Download and unzip the Maya Loader http://www.smartibl.com/sibl/loader.html
- Copy the extracted files to:
Mac OS X
Open sIBL-GUI. You are prompted with “Would you like to add some IBL sets” – answer No
A window “Remote Updater” opens – press “Get Latest Templates” (deactivate the ones you do not need) – Select save Location (easiest is simply factory)
After the update Close the Download Manager and Remote Updater
In the Main Program select “Export” then “Open Output Directory”
Copy the Path of that Folder it should be something like:
Open/Restart Maya. Open the Shelf “sIBL_GUI”
Click on the first Icon “p”.
Insert the Path to “Loader Script Path” and select sIBL_Maya_Import.py
ADDING SIBL-SETS TO SIBL_GUI
Extract the file into any folder you like on your Hard drive. I have my files organized In a folder called C:\Resources\HDR\sIBL.
Open up sIBL_GUI.
In Library Mode right click in the middle panel and select “Add sIBL set …”
Your First sIBL render
We will be using a sIBL of a tropical beach in Barbados to render a teapot. However you can use whatever image and model you like.
- A model – Download: teapot
- A sIBL Image – Download: http://www.hdrlabs.com/sibl/archive.html and download the file “Tropical Beach”
IMPORT SIBL TO MAYA:
Import the teapot to Maya (File > Import )
Open sIBL, Add the “Tropical Beach” to the Libary (In Library Mode right click in the middle panel and select “Add sIBL set …” )
Select the “Export” panel
In the left panel select “Mental Ray Standard” (Creates an environment)
In the middle panel select the Image, in the right panel click Output Loader script
Back in Maya go to the sIBL shelf and click on the E (execute)
In the Outliner you see a group “sIBL” has been created. It includes a transparent floor to receive shadows.
In the Hypershade you can Graph the persp-Camera here you see the entire IBL-network that has been created. If you create a new Camera you have to connect the sIBL_mip_rayswitch to the mental ray > Environment Shader Attribute
In the Viewport activate Shaded and Textured mode (Press the key 6)
Position your Render Camera
Apply a “mia_material_x” shader to the teapot (A white tone)
Test render (make sure Final Gather is activated)
If the image is too bright, check the Gamma Settings on the “sIBL_mia_exposure_simple” and set it to 1.0
Adjust Final Gather settings and Anti-Alias Settings for Final Render (increase Accuracy, Point Density) and then do your final Render.